After the release of their single Honey last October, The Citradels have released their latest LP ‘Are They Still Here?’ on vinyl via psych rock label Psychic Ric Records. All five members decided to camp out in isolation for 5 days and record the album in a 50 year old disused butter factory in rural Victoria. The band chose the space for its emptiness, its history, and wanted to place themselves in an atmosphere where they could do nothing but complete the album. a2381714-90cd-44a0-a3f4-a9ddfb073e03To some The Citradels are one of Melbourne’s most underground psych-rock outfits. ‘Are They Still Here?’ is the band’s sixth full length album in six years. The band attempts to release as much as they can to keep gigging and stay relevant in the local psych scene.

The Citradels in the past have been produced more “drone and roll” tunes complete with fuzz guitar and sitars that induce listeners into a meditative state. The band wears its influences on its sleeve with ‘Are They Still Here?’ has a rather electric undertone harking back to classic shoegaze legends such as Slowdive and Ride, but with an edgier air to it along the lines of Spacemen 3. The five piece neo psych/showgaze/drone have managed to capture fuzzy riff based numbers but also have a few slow burners to bliss out to.
